Start with the basics that fit your life. Get some stuff that will last: jeans that fit great, a blazer that goes with everything, a white shirt, comfy flats or boots with a little heel, and a dress you can wear in different ways. These things will make getting dressed way easier. Pick styles that look good on you. Even a cheap piece of clothing can look amazing if it fits well! And go for good materials, like cotton, wool, silk, and linen. They usually look better and last longer than the cheap stuff.
Color and how things fit are super important. Figure out what colors look best on you and make a small collection of clothes in those colors—like three to five—that all go together. Mix up the materials to make things more interesting. For example, try a soft sweater with a leather skirt or a cotton shirt with a silk scarf. When it comes to how things fit, pair baggy clothes with tighter clothes to keep things looking good. Like, wear a big sweater with skinny pants or wide pants with a short jacket.
Your makeup should help your style, not fight it. Focus on basic skincare first. Cleanse gently, protect from the sun, and moisturize. Good sunscreen and light lotion can make your skin look way better over time. You can add things like serums or retinol if you want. For makeup, just focus on making your natural features pop. Clean skin, good eyebrows, some mascara, and a lip color that makes you feel good can be better than a bunch of makeup.
Taking care of your hair matters too. Get regular cuts, protect it from heat, and use conditioner. Simple tools and a few easy hairstyles - like a low bun, soft waves, or a ponytail - can get you ready for anything. Think about having one thing that’s always part of your look. Like parting your hair a certain way or wearing the same accessory.
Accessories can turn a basic outfit into something special. Start with the things you need: a bag that fits your stuff, comfy shoes, and a belt. Then add things that show who you are. You can use jewelry to bring attention to your face or your hands. Pick simple pieces for daytime and bolder pieces for nighttime. Scarves, hats, and sunglasses are useful and stylish. They’re cheap ways to make your outfits feel new and work for different seasons.
When you pick accessories, try to have things that either match or stand out. A plain outfit looks great with a textured bag or a patterned scarf. A colorful dress can look better with simple jewelry. It’s better to have fewer, nicer accessories. If you take care of them - polish your jewelry, store your leather things in the right way, and keep everything clean - they’ll last longer and keep your whole look polished.
